Good: Cheap and supports external drive sync.
Bad: extremely slow, unreliable sync (doesn't always detect changes, sometimes Windows service just doesn't run), bandwidth "intelligent" feature doesn't work. On top of that, awful UI, and dodgy behaviour, including app adding shortcut to Desktop every time it starts.
Would not recommend.

Switched to iDrive from iCloud due to iCloud regularly failing to upload larger files even though I was paying for tons of storage space. Enough was enough and I moved to iDrive.
So far, so good! Plenty of space (5TB) for a very reasonable price, automatically backs up my selected folders to a cloud drive.
Customer services have been great so far, my only disappointment was being told that Mac Time Machine Backups may not work when backed up using their express drive service.
The service is reliable, although I've experienced minor issues and bugs when dealing with backups and downloads from synced devices. The UI looks very old and is not particularly user friendly. Servers are very slow, and often non responsive. I was put off by dark patterns used by this company:
- couldn't downgrade to the free plan, I had to contact them because it's impossible from the UI (which is also illegal in the EU, as far as I know). Massive waste of time and very confusing, because the UI kept saying that I am on a paid plan (and still does, after a few months).
- The deleted data still adds up to the total space used, even months after deleting. I had to upgrade because I thought I needed more space, and realized later that it was not the case.
I am now on a free plan that I use purely to backup my photos from Android, which works well because it preserved the same folder structure as on Android. Another option would be the FolderSync app, which costs only €7.

I have been a user of iDrive Backup on my PC since September of 2013. I use it to backup my valuable documents and photos. I have thousands of old family photos I have scanned in, so these are very precious to me.
I have almost 5 TB stored on iDrive.
I have setup up the iDrive app to run nightly backups and it sends me an email telling me what was backed up and if there was any issues.
Over all the years that I've been using iDrive there has not been a time that I needed to restore something and it was not on iDrive.
One of the best features I like about iDrive is the versioning. That saved me recently when the file on the computer size was 0 kb, so I restored from the version before. I would have spent hours recreating the data in that file.
Another recent event where iDrive saved me. I recently purchased a NAS and moved files from internal hard drives to the NAS. Apparently the program that I used to do the "move" didn't do it's job and I wound up with missing files.
iDrive to the rescue again. I downloaded what I had stored on iDrive and was able to rebuild the folders/files on my new NAS.
All of this has happened in the last few months.
iDrive does what it is supposed to do.
Another point I want to make is their support. The few times I called iDrive Tech Support I always get to speak to a human, which is unusual these days. I'm picky about Tech Support, as I was in IT for many years, but I have no complaints about the support I've received from iDrive Tech Support.
I'm a very satisfied customer, thank you iDrive.

iDrive does not recognize that files were deleted on another computer and uploads them again. Then they get downloaded to the computer where they were previously deleted. This is a BIG issue and makes it impossible for me to use iDrive to keep a set of files current between 3 computers.
UPDATE 1/2/24 - I contacted iDrive Support with this issue and received the following response:
We request you to elaborate your query to assist you better.
However, if you looking to remove the files from your IDrive cloud space, please make sure that after deleting the files from the IDrive cloud you have deselected the same files from the IDrive backup set on your computer.
Thanks,
Your IDrive Support Team
We hope this response has sufficiently answered your questions. If you have additional questions or information regarding the issue, please reply to this email.
No, the response did not answer my question at all. This is a known problem, not a new issue, with this software.

Basically does what it says on the tin, keeps backups of selected data with plenty of storage for a reasonable price.
Why the 3 stars? well if you're like me and upgrade your system often then here is one thing to keep in mind.
I've just installed a 2tb NVME SSD as I wanted a faster drive for my photos and videos, the old HDD is way to slow these days. Nice easy job, drive up and running now just need to redirect IDrive to the new folder locations, except you can't! (customer service confirmed this) meaning that 500Gb of data now needs uploading again even though it already exists, 3 days in so far and still uploading!
I also backup to Amazon photos, no problems here, redirect the app to the new location, 10 minutes while it verified the files and job done.
